Abstract

In this paper, we designed and manufactured a thigh link integrated hip joint torque sensor for walking aid robot. The torque sensor is designed and built on the hip joint of the thigh link, which is combined with the waist block. This sensor is used to control the torque when a patient walks with a walking aid robot. In order to manufacture this torque sensor, the sensor sensing part is composed of hollow core type, and it is designed to output the rated strain at the position of strain gage through structural analysis and is produced by attaching a strain gauge. Characteristic test of the manufactured torque sensor showed that the error was less than 0.04%. Therefore, it can be used as a hip joint torque sensor for walking aid robot.
